Executive summary

  • Achieved strong Q2 results with net income of $63.1 million, up from $27.5 million, and adjusted EPS of $0.39, driven by margin gains, a significant land sale, and robust Americas performance, especially in education and government.

  • Continued progress on strategic pillars: workplace transformation, diversification, profitability, and ESG initiatives, including a commitment to net-zero carbon emissions by 2050.

  • Maintained market share gains and high win rates in the Americas, while International markets remained soft except for India.

  • Published annual impact report highlighting progress on community, inclusion, sustainability, and increased use of recycled content in packaging to 40%.

  • Leveraged research-driven innovation and ongoing acquisitions to diversify offerings and adapt to changing workplace needs.

Financial highlights

  • Q2 revenue was $855.8 million, nearly flat year-over-year, with gross margin improving to 34.5% (up 130–140 bps), and adjusted operating income rising to $68.5 million (8.0% margin).

  • Adjusted EPS for Q2 was $0.39, up from $0.31, and trailing four-quarter adjusted EBITDA reached $285.3 million (9.1% of revenue).

  • Cash and short-term investments totaled $335.8 million as of August 23, 2024, with total liquidity at $507.1 million, exceeding total debt of $446.7 million.

  • Returned $45 million to shareholders via dividends and share repurchases in the first half; dividends paid totaled $24.0 million.

  • Operating expenses decreased by $30.8 million, reflecting land sale gains and lower International costs.

Outlook and guidance

  • Q3 revenue expected between $785–$810 million, reflecting 1–5% organic growth year-over-year; adjusted EPS guidance of $0.21–$0.25.

  • Fiscal 2025 adjusted EPS target range reaffirmed at $0.85–$1.00.

  • Gross margin projected at 32.5–33.0%; operating expenses $225–$230 million.

  • Mid-term targets include 4–6% average annual organic revenue growth and $50M+ in operational cost reductions.

  • Confident in achieving higher end of FY25 adjusted EPS target, but timing of large project orders and ERP cutover could impact quarterly phasing.
